South Dakota to Montana Parks Explorer
Usually CAD $2,683 per person; sale price: CAD $2,330 (a savings of $353)

Travellers will visit the iconic sites like Mount Rushmore, Badlands National Park and Yellowstone to watch Old Faithful spray water into the air, in addition to an intimate visit to Little Bighorn Battlefield National Monument, where they will join a Crow Nation Guide for a tour which provides an Apsaalooke perspective on the conflict. With a tribal historian at their side, they will traverse the battlefield and learn how Lakota, Cheyenne and Arapaho warriors defeated the US Army on the Greasy Grass at the Battle of the Little Bighorn.

The Maritimes: Prince Edward Island and New Brunswick
Usually CAD $2,455 per person; sale price: CAD $2,086.75 (a savings of $386)

Experience the seaside charm of Prince Edward Island and New Brunswick on this 6-day Maritimes trip from Charlottetown to Saint John. Start at the birthplace of Canadian Confederation, then visit the home of Anne of Green Gables, enjoy lunch on board a working lobster boat, and meet with a local Knowledge Keeper from the Abegweit Mi’kmaq First Nation. Stop at the iconic Hopewell Rocks for a stroll along the Bay of Fundy’s ocean floor at low tide before finishing up in Canada’s oldest city.

What’s Intrepid Travel known for? The world’s largest adventure travel company, Intrepid Travel offers more than 1,000 trips on all seven continents. As a certified B Corp that has been carbon neutral for more than a decade, Intrepid leads small group tours (averaging 10 people) the local way, offering real life experiences that give back to the destinations they visit.
